Fudgy Gluten Free Strawberry Brownies

These Gluten Free Fudgy Strawberry Brownies are a rich and delicious take on traditional brownies. They are also gluten free and refined sugar free, topped with strawberry jam and freeze dried strawberries. I love making these for Valentine's Day!

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350F and line a 9x9 or 8x8 baking dish with parchment paper.
  • Melt the coconut oil and chocolate chips together. You can do this over the stove or in 30 second increments in the microwave, mixing regularly.
  • Once chocolate mixture is smooth, whisk in the cocoa powder. Set aside to cool slightly.
  • In a stand mixer (or with a hand mixer, although this will be a little more labor intensive), beat together the eggs and coconut sugar for 3-5 minutes until the mixture is lighter in color and fluffier.
  • Add the chocolate mixture and vanilla extract and beat on low until just combined.
  • Fold in the dry ingredients until just mixed. You can fold in some extra chocolate chips at this stage if you would like, as well.
  • Pour the batter into your baking dish and smooth out the top.
  • Add dollops of the jam on top of the brownie batter. Use a toothpick or chopstick to swirl the jam evenly all over the top of the brownies. Next, sprinkle on your crushed freeze dried strawberries. You can use less/more as desired.
  • Bake for 18-22 minutes until a toothpick just comes out clean. Check it at 18 minutes and watch the brownies closely from then. You don't want to over bake brownies.
  • Remove and let cool for 10-15 minutes before removing from the baking dish by using the parchment paper.
